Solution Overview

Problem

The installation and upgrading of 5G cellular network towers are costly and complex due to their lower range and poor propagation qualities, requiring different equipment for each tower, necessitating a more efficient and cost-effective installation method.

Innovation Solution

A manufactured utility apparatus comprising a base module, ice bridge module, equipment cabinet module, cable securing module, H-frame module, antenna module, grounding module, generator module, GPS antenna, and Wi-Fi module, which can be pre-assembled and easily transported and installed on cellular towers, reducing traditional construction needs and allowing for faster attachment and detachment of components.

Engineering Contradictions & Design Principles

VSEngineering Contradiction Analysis

1Productivity

If traditional construction methods are used for installing cellular network towers, then the installation is more stable and permanent, but the installation process becomes more costly and time-consuming

Engineering Contradiction:
Improveinstallation speedVSAvoidinstallation complexity
Core Design Contradiction:
ProductivityVSDevice complexity

Solution Approach 1:

The utility apparatus is divided into multiple detachable modules including base module, equipment cabinet module, H-frame module, antenna module, and accessory modules. Each module can be independently manufactured, transported, and installed, significantly reducing installation complexity and time while maintaining structural integrity through standardized coupling mechanisms.

Inventive Principle:
Principle #1Segmentation

Solution Approach 2:

The modular components are pre-assembled and pre-configured in a manufacturing setting before deployment. The base module includes pre-installed grounding systems, the equipment cabinet module contains pre-mounted equipment, and connection interfaces are pre-prepared, allowing for rapid on-site installation without extensive construction work.

Inventive Principle:
Principle #10Preliminary action

2Adaptability or versatility

If custom equipment is installed for each tower to meet specific requirements, then the system adapts better to different tower specifications, but the installation cost and complexity increase

Engineering Contradiction:
Improvetower specification adaptabilityVSAvoidinstallation ease
Core Design Contradiction:
Adaptability or versatilityVSEase of manufacture

Solution Approach 1:

The utility apparatus employs standardized modular components with universal connection interfaces that can be adapted to different tower types and specifications. The base module, equipment cabinet module, and H-frame module are designed with standardized mounting interfaces allowing the same modular components to be installed on various tower configurations without custom manufacturing, reducing both cost and complexity.

Inventive Principle:
Principle #6Universality (Multi-functionality)

3Reliability

If permanent construction methods are used for tower installation, then the infrastructure is more stable, but relocation becomes difficult and disruptive

Engineering Contradiction:
Improveinstallation stabilityVSAvoidrelocation ease
Core Design Contradiction:
ReliabilityVSEase of operation

Solution Approach 1:

The utility apparatus transitions from static permanent installation to dynamic reconfigurable installation. The modular components are connected through detachable coupling mechanisms that provide stable, reliable connections during operation but allow for easy disconnection and relocation. The standardized interfaces ensure consistent mechanical and electrical connections while enabling rapid deployment and relocation without extensive construction or demolition work.

Inventive Principle:
Principle #15Dynamics

AI summary

In one aspect, the present disclosure relates to a manufactured utility apparatus that includes a base module, an ice bridge module attached to the base module, and an equipment cabinet module attached to the base module. The manufactured utility apparatus may include a cable securing module attached to the base module. The cable securing module may be configured to electrically connect the utility apparatus and a utility resource. The manufactured utility apparatus may further include an H-frame module attached to the base module, and an antenna module attached to the base module, the antenna module being operatively connected to the utility resource. The manufactured utility apparatus may include a grounding module configured to electrically ground the utility apparatus and the utility resource.
